Kafka與傳統(tǒng)消息系統(tǒng)相比具有以下優(yōu)勢:
- 高吞吐量:Kafka能夠處理大量的消息并實(shí)現(xiàn)高吞吐量,適合處理大規(guī)模的數(shù)據(jù)流。
- 高可靠性:Kafka實(shí)現(xiàn)了消息的持久化存儲和數(shù)據(jù)冗余備份,保證消息的可靠性和不丟失。
- 可水平擴(kuò)展:Kafka可以通過增加節(jié)點(diǎn)來實(shí)現(xiàn)水平擴(kuò)展,提高系統(tǒng)的負(fù)載能力和性能。
- 高可用性:Kafka支持集群部署和數(shù)據(jù)復(fù)制,能夠提供高可用性的消息傳輸服務(wù)。
- 實(shí)時(shí)處理:Kafka支持實(shí)時(shí)數(shù)據(jù)處理和流式計(jì)算,能夠滿足實(shí)時(shí)數(shù)據(jù)分析和處理的需求。
- 多種數(shù)據(jù)處理方式:Kafka支持多種數(shù)據(jù)處理方式,如批處理、流處理、復(fù)雜事件處理等,能夠適應(yīng)不同的數(shù)據(jù)處理場景。